Blue German Shepherds

German Shepherds are famous for their intelligence and training ability. To stay healthy and happy, they need to engage in a daily exercise routine and receive mental stimulation.

Blue Shepherds are German Shepherds who have an dilution gene that has a double dose. This makes their black fur appear blue. This genetic variation is a normal occurrence.

Health

Blue German Shepherds are healthy dogs, however, they are susceptible to specific health issues, such as hip and elbow dysplasia. Responsible breeding and regular vet visits can reduce the risks. They also require adequate exercise and a balanced diet in order to remain healthy and happy.

Their double-layered coat needs regular brushing to prevent matting and reduce shedding. They will also require periodic bathing and ear cleaning. For their health, it's vital to feed them an adequate diet that is in line with their level of activity. Routine veterinary checks and vaccinations are also advised.

Blue German Shepherds live on average between 9 and 13 years if they are treated with care and lead an active, healthy lifestyle. Like all breeds Blue German Shepherds are prone to certain health issues, like hip and elbow dysplasia as well as degenerative myelopathy. They also may suffer from congenital heart conditions such as pulmonic and elbow stenosis as well as patent ductus.
